The existence of two diverse classes of PEA–hydrolytic enzymes raises the dilemma regarding that is the most important with regard for the catabolism of PEA. The small solution to this dilemma is that it's dependent on which tissue/cell line is under research, if the sickness process for every se has affected the relative expression of FAAH and NAAA and no matter whether we are thinking about endogenous or exogenous PEA. Endogenous and exogenous PEA are viewed as individually in The 2 pursuing subsections.

Together with its absorption, the presystemic metabolism of PEA is a crucial determinant of its bioavailability. The hydrolytic enzymes involved in PEA metabolism are expressed from the intestine and also the liver (see Area 2.five), and upon incubation of rat liver homogenates with 50 nM PEA, a 50 %-life of the lipid of about 25 min was discovered [eleven]. To our understanding, there is absolutely no facts during the literature with regards to the bioavailability of PEA or, Probably additional importantly, how this may differ between people today. A method of circumventing presystemic metabolism is using PEA prodrugs.
